首页 > 其他
OJ:约数个数
题目来源:http://ac.jobdu.com/problem.php?pid=1087 方法1:类似于判断质数,只需要枚举 sqrt(n) 个数就可以得到n的约数个数了,效率很高,10亿没问题。 #include #include #include int num[1005]; int main() { int N; while (scanf("%d", &N) != EOF...
分类:其他   时间:2014-01-26 18:59:20    收藏:0  评论:0  赞:0  阅读:387
Cocos2d-x 3.0 新特性体验(2) 回调函数的变化
在cocos2d-x 2.x版本中的回调函数的用法想必大家都很是熟悉,例如在menu item,call back action中都需要大量的使用到回调函数,但是在使用过程中总是感觉到比较冗余麻烦的,在3.0版本,使用到了C++11 的新特性,改进增加了回到函数的使用形式,其中最令人欣慰的是,可以使用闭包,对于有过iOS开发经验的来说,应该很亲切,就是 block。 下面将通过几个例子详细介...
分类:其他   时间:2014-01-26 18:52:20    收藏:0  评论:0  赞:0  阅读:555
UVa 537 人工智能
/* *  解题思路: * 题意比较好理解,就是给出P = U*I 中的两个量求第三个量、 纯靠细心! *      容易错的点、就每组数据还要再多输出一个空行、最后一组也要!( ps: 如果发现自己WA、多拿几组数据测下看哪里出错、情况就那么几种、试下就行了!) */ #include #include int main( ) { int t; int i,j;...
分类:其他   时间:2014-01-26 18:58:50    收藏:0  评论:0  赞:0  阅读:362
最好用图像处理库CxImage入门
CxImage是一款免费的、开源的、功能强大的图形处理库。跨平台,支持windows、linux等;支持BMP、GIF、ICO、TGA、JPEG、PCX、PNG、TIFF、MNG、RAS等多种图像格式;支持格式转换、图像处理、几何变换等;最重要的是使用非常简单。...
分类:其他   时间:2014-01-26 18:36:20    收藏:0  评论:0  赞:0  阅读:700
界面与程序员的不解之缘
从开始做gxpt这个项目开始,到现在也有一段时间了。通过这段时间的开发,渐渐的熟悉了新的开发环境,对大致的流程了一个简单的了解。从之前的仿照例子,到之后自己独立开发,一直到现在可以自己调试代码(第一次接触的时候,出现了错误完全不知道该去哪里寻找原因,更不用说修改了),应该说是有不少收获的。         但是,在开发过程中,由于每个人负责一个独立的模块,彼此之间很少有交流的机会。大家都有点...
分类:其他   时间:2014-01-26 19:01:20    收藏:0  评论:0  赞:0  阅读:350
初始UML ,我们应该了解什么?
看了《UML基础与应用》的1-4集视频,我了解到了刘惠老师要讲解的整个课程的主要内容和重点。下面就让我用一幅图来概括一下,我们在这门课程中主要的学习内容:              在学习这门课程时,我们要带着问题去学习: 什么是面向对象?什么是可视化建模?UML如何构成?UML在软件过程中如何应用?        前两个问题为我们理解UML做铺垫,第三个问题是UML的基础,而第四...
分类:其他   时间:2014-01-26 18:54:50    收藏:0  评论:0  赞:0  阅读:365
国产游戏自己坑自己的5个功能
1、“过度强大”的新手引导         好的产品,是不需要说明书的。我一向比较反苹果,唯独这一点我支持。         但是对于游戏来说,做到这点不容易,所以退一步,好的游戏,是不需要太复杂的引导的。         以前的游戏是怎么引导的,ACT只教你上下左右拳脚刀剑,RTS教你左键走路还是右键走路,街机教你打跳看用,FPS教你开枪买枪。或者是通过一系列简单的任务教程,你遵循我的指导...
分类:其他   时间:2014-01-26 18:42:20    收藏:0  评论:0  赞:0  阅读:354
几种统计整数二进制表示中1的个数(算法小学习)
这是一个很有意思的问题,是在面试中特别容易被问到的问题之一,这个问题有一个正式的名字叫 Hamming weight。 解决这个问题第一想法肯定是一位一位的去判断,是1计数器+1,否则不操作,跳到下一位,十分容易,编程初学者就可以做得到! 于是很容易得到这样的程序: int Sum1ByBin(int num) { int sum = 0; while (num) {...
分类:其他   时间:2014-01-26 18:54:20    收藏:0  评论:0  赞:0  阅读:318
UVa882 The Mailbox Manufacturers Problem
The Mailbox Manufacturers Problem   In the good old days when Swedish children were still allowed to blow up their fingers with fire-crackers, gangs of excited kids would plague certain smaller citi...
分类:其他   时间:2014-01-26 18:58:20    收藏:0  评论:0  赞:0  阅读:653
RUP简介
RUP(Rational Unified Process),统一软件开发过程,是目前影响较大的、面向对象的软件开发过程。   为了更好的支持和促进软件开发,RUP以保持最佳实践的中心思想提供了一套以UML为基础的开发准则,用以指导软件开发人员以UML为基础进行软件开发,使得开发团队成员可以共享同一个知识库、同一个开发过程、同一个开发视图、同一种建模语言;并通过迭代式开发、管理需求、使用构件架构...
分类:其他   时间:2014-01-26 18:35:50    收藏:0  评论:0  赞:0  阅读:392
一些 平常需要用到的 监听
时间的监听,软件的安装卸载监听 /** 权限 * ...
分类:其他   时间:2014-01-26 19:02:50    收藏:0  评论:0  赞:0  阅读:427
【iphone游戏开发】iphone-Cocos2D游戏开发之二:精灵表的详细讲解(一)和Zwoptex工具的使用
1.精灵表的分类: 简单精灵表:精灵表中的图片都具有相同维度 复杂精灵表:精灵表中的图片可以具有不同的维度。 2.简单精灵表 通过SpriteSheet类将提供的图像切割成大小相同的子图像,当一个新的精灵表被实例化时将提供切割时用到的维度,同时也将提供精灵表图像中已用的“间隔”信息。 3.复杂精灵表...
分类:其他   时间:2014-01-26 18:41:50    收藏:0  评论:0  赞:0  阅读:368
Unix/Linux sudo命令
1. sudo命令允许管理分配给普通用户一些合理的“权利”,让它们执行一些只有超级用户甚至特许用户才能完成的任务。但用户自执行sudo并输入密码后,用户获得一张默认存活期为5分钟的“入场券”。超时以后,用户必须重新输入密码。 sudo配置文件默认存放在 /etc/sudoers  (查看修改该文件需要root权限),但不建议直接使用vim编辑这个文件,而是使用 visudo 这个命令来编辑这个...
分类:其他   时间:2014-01-26 18:56:50    收藏:0  评论:0  赞:0  阅读:358
canvas学习1
Insert title here #myCanvas { border:1px solid #000; } var canvas = document.getElementById("myCanvas"); var y = 250; var x = 150; var flag = "right"; var ctx = canvas.getContext("2d")...
分类:其他   时间:2014-01-26 18:43:50    收藏:0  评论:0  赞:0  阅读:356
创建型模式(1)
1、FACTORY —追MM少不了请吃饭了,麦当劳的鸡翅和肯德基的鸡翅都是MM爱吃的东西,虽然口味有所不同,但不管你带MM去麦当劳或肯德基,只管向服务员说“来四个鸡翅”就行了。麦当劳和肯德基就是生产鸡翅的Factory  工厂模式:客户类和工厂类分开。消费者任何时候需要某种产品,只需向工厂请求即可。消费者无须修改就可以接纳新产品。缺点是当产品修改时,工厂类也要做相应的修改。如:如何创建及如何...
分类:其他   时间:2014-01-26 18:56:20    收藏:0  评论:0  赞:0  阅读:322
结构型模式(2)
6、ADAPTER —在朋友聚会上碰到了一个美女Sarah,从香港来的,可我不会说粤语,她不会说普通话,只好求助于我的朋友kent了,他作为我和Sarah之间的Adapter,让我和Sarah可以相互交谈了(也不知道他会不会耍我)  适配器模式:把一个类的接口变换成客户端所期待的另一种接口,从而使原本因接口原因不匹配而无法一起工作的两个类能够一起工作。适配类可以根据参数返还一个合适的实例给客...
分类:其他   时间:2014-01-26 18:44:50    收藏:0  评论:0  赞:0  阅读:362
机房收费系统之CDM
在写文档的过程中,肯定会有系统数据库的设计,那么如何进行数据库的设计呢?先来给大家说明一个概念:          CDM:概念数据模型(CDM,Conceptual Data Model)用于从概念层开始设计过程。因为在概念层,无须考虑实际物理实现的细节。CDM 描述数据库的整体逻辑结构。它独立于任何软件或具体的数据存取结构,能够对《需求规格说明书》中的业务需求进行形式化描述。它的主要作用是:...
分类:其他   时间:2014-01-26 18:41:20    收藏:0  评论:0  赞:0  阅读:447
行为模式 (3)
13、CHAIN OF RESPONSIBLEITY —晚上去上英语课,为了好开溜坐到了最后一排,哇,前面坐了好几个漂亮的MM哎,找张纸条,写上“Hi,可以做我的女朋友吗?如果不愿意请向前传”,纸条就一个接一个的传上去了,糟糕,传到第一排的MM把纸条传给老师了,听说是个老处女呀,快跑!  责任链模式: 在责任链模式中,很多对象由每一个对象对其下家的引用而接起来形成一条链。请求在这个链上传递,...
分类:其他   时间:2014-01-26 18:53:50    收藏:0  评论:0  赞:0  阅读:348
hdu 2870 Largest Submatrix
思路分析: 枚举a b c  然后用 hdu  1505  类似的方式求出最大的子矩阵。 #include #include #include #include using namespace std; int n,m; int map[1005][1005]; char save[1005][1005]; int l[1005]; int r[1005]; int mai...
分类:其他   时间:2014-01-26 18:51:20    收藏:0  评论:0  赞:0  阅读:315
ORA-03106: fatal two-task communication protocol error
?? ORA-03106: fatal two-task communication protocol error two-task common errors are generally RDBMS related issues, but could be caused by a problem with SQL*Net, or an application (i.e. P...
分类:其他   时间:2014-01-26 18:42:50    收藏:0  评论:0  赞:0  阅读:1194
关于我们 - 联系我们 - 留言反馈 - 联系我们:wmxa8@hotmail.com
© 2014 bubuko.com 版权所有
打开技术之扣,分享程序人生!